Summary:<em>Acute epiglottitis (AE) must be considered as not a separate entdisease but as compound pathology with wide polymorphism, which can often need an intervention of different medical specialists: experts in resuscitation, infectiologists, immunologists, pulmonologists, and cardiologists. The increase of rate of AE and its septic complications and severe outcomes in last years forced us to consider this problem in detail on the basis of longstanding experience of Morozov children's city clinical hospital.</em><br /><strong><em>Key words: children, acute epiglottitis, etiology, diagnosis, treatment.</em></strong>
